Kitchen Cupboard Refinishing in Kokomo, IN
Kitchen cupboard refinishing services involve restoring and updating the appearance of existing cabinets without the need for complete replacement. This process typically includes sanding, repairing, and applying new finishes or paint to refresh worn or outdated cabinetry, helping to improve the overall look of a kitchen. Projects can range from revitalizing a single set of cabinets to refinishing entire kitchen units, making it a popular choice for homeowners seeking a cost-effective way to update their space.
Property owners often want to understand the scope of work involved, including surface preparation, the types of finishes available, and how the process can impact the durability of cabinets. It’s also helpful to consider the condition of existing cabinetry, as refinishing is most effective on cabinets that are structurally sound but show signs of wear or outdated aesthetics. Clarifying expectations around the finish quality, drying times, and maintenance can ensure satisfaction with the completed project.

Kitchen Cupboard Refinishing Questions
What is kitchen cupboard refinishing? It is a process that refreshes the appearance of existing cabinets by applying new finishes or paints, giving them a like-new look.
Which cabinet styles can be refinished? Most styles, including traditional, modern, and shaker, can be refinished to match any interior design.
How long does refinishing typically last? Properly done refinishing can maintain its appearance for several years with regular cleaning.
What types of finishes are available? Options include paint, stain, glaze, and protective topcoats to achieve the desired look and durability.
